A Must-Visit Whisky Bar in Edinburgh
Whether you love whisky or are just getting into it, this venue is a great place to enjoy a dram or two. Located in the centre of Edinburgh in a beautiful Victorian building, The Scotch Malt Whisky Society Kaleidoscope Whisky Bar is open to all. Join in a group tasting or private party or simply just pop in for an after-work drink.
